Paul O’Donohoe is a scholar working on Economics and Econometrics, General Health Professions and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Paul O’Donohoe has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 440 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Economics and Econometrics, 5 papers in General Health Professions and 4 papers in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Paul O’Donohoe’s work include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(6 papers), Delphi Technique in Research (4 papers) and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(3 papers). Paul O’Donohoe is often cited by papers focused on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(6 papers), Delphi Technique in Research (4 papers) and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(3 papers). Paul O’Donohoe coll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Spain. Paul O’Donohoe's co-authors include Sonya Eremenco, Stephen Joel Coons, Bill Byrom, David S. Reasner and Willie Muehlhausen and has published in prestigious journals such as BMC Psychiatry, Health and Quality of Life Outcomes and Value in Health.
